Resources for the 2018 Referendum on Electoral Reform

The 2018 Referendum on Electoral Reform is being held by mail from October 22 to November 30, 2018. Registered voters will receive a voting package in the mail from Elections BC between October 22 and November 2, 2018. If you are not already registered, phone Elections BC at 1-800-661-8683.

Elections BC wants to ensure that all eligible voters in British Columbia have the information they need to register and vote.

PRELIMINARY Post-Fire Risk Analysis Report V82441 Gold Valley Main

This preliminary risk analysis report has been provided by the Ministry of Forests, Lands, Natural Resource Operations and Rural Development. The results given in this report are preliminary in nature and are intended to be a warning of potential hazards and risks. This is not a final risk analysis and further work may alter the conclusions.
